NCAA-College-Football-Picks-Odds-and-Predictions2013 College Football Picks: LSU @ Georgia Odds and Predictions – Free College Football Picks 9/28/2013: Another huge game in the SEC is on tap this weekend when the sixth-ranked LSU Tigers (4-0, 1-0 SEC) visit the ninth-ranked Georgia Bulldogs (2-1, 1-0 SEC). Both teams have national title and conference title aspirations, but the loser of Saturday’s showdown is going to be facing an uphill battle for both. Plenty is at stake in this one, and playing at home, the Bulldogs are currently 3-point favorites.

The game will be the first big test for the Tigers, who have looked like a much more balanced team in 2013. Quarterback Zach Mettenberger has thrown 10 touchdowns compared to just one interception, running back Jeremy Hill has rushed for 350 yards and six scores, and receivers Odell Beckham and Jarvis Landry have both surpassed 300 yards. LSU’s defense has also been solid, allowing less than 20 points per game despite several new starters.

For Georgia, the showdown with another top-10 team is becoming routine. After all, LSU will be the third top-10 opponent the Bulldogs have faced in four games this season. As expected, the Georgia offense has been stout throughout the year, and the Bulldogs enter the game averaging more than 40 points per game. Quarterback Aaron Murray is averaging more than 300 yards per game and completing 72.0 percent of his passes. Meanwhile, running back Todd Gurley is averaging more than 100 yards per game on 6.0 yards per carry. On the flip side, Georgia’s rebuilt defense has struggled and is allowing nearly 30 points per game.

The Tigers Win If:

If the Tigers are going to go on the road and pull off an upset, they need to win the battle in the trenches. Both teams have powerful ground attacks, but LSU’s punishing style is more crucial to the team’s overall success. By controlling the pace of the game, the Tigers can keep their defense well rested and make life easier for Mettenberger. While LSU actually has plenty of firepower on offense, the last thing the Tigers want to do is get into a high-scoring shootout with Murray and the Bulldogs. If the Tigers get their ground game rolling early, they can wear down an already-suspect Georgia defense and outlast the Bulldogs.

The Bulldogs Win If:

If the Bulldogs are going to knock off the Tigers, they need to at least slow down the LSU ground game. While expecting the Bulldogs’ defense to suddenly become stingy is a reach, if Georgia can at least take away the Tigers’ ground attack, they should be in good shape. Meanwhile, the Bulldogs need to maintain a balanced attack on offense and attack the LSU defense through the air and on the ground. The Tigers are tough to beat when the can dictate the pace from the start of the game, but if Murray and company can get their offense rolling early and force Mettenberger and company try to keep pace, the Bulldogs should be able to overwhelm LSU with their offense.

Bottom Line:

Ironically, neither quarterback in this matchup has a history of performing well in big games, and while Murray has been the productive QB overall, the Tigers appear to be the more balanced team in this matchup. The Bulldogs’ defense has been porous all year, and it is going to backfire against a team like the Tigers that can control the tempo with their loaded backfield and physical offensive line. The Tigers should have little trouble establishing their ground game early, and from there, they should be on their way to a win.
